Fourth of July: What's Closed, What's Open

Independence Day is a federal and state holiday.

Thursday is Independence Day, more commonly referred to as the Fourth of July. It is a state and federal holiday. Here is what's closed and what's open on the Fourth of July.

Here is what's closed:

Upper Macungie Township municipal offices will be closed Thursday and Friday.  (No trash pickup Thursday; pickups will be a day later).

The Lehigh County Courthouse

District Judge Michael Faulkner's office

State offices, including PennDOT driver's license and photo centers. (Driver and vehicle online services are available. www.dmv.state.pa.us

Federal offices 

Post offices, and no mail pickup or delivery. Express Mail will be delivered.

Pennsylvania Liquor stores

Banks (Most are closed.) 

Also on Thursday:

Retail: Most retail and entertainment establishments are open.
